What is a 20 Ft Box Container?
A 20 ft box container is a rectangle-shaped steel container with a capacity specifically created to assist in the transportation of items by sea, land, or rail. It has become a standard measure in the shipping market, offering a dependable technique for both domestic and worldwide shipping.
Dimensions and Specifications
Here’s an in-depth table of the requirements and Dimensions Of 20ft Container of a basic 20 ft box container:
DimensionMeasurementExternal Length20 ft (6.058 m)External Width8 ft (2.438 m)External Height8.5 ft (2.591 m)Internal Length19.4 ft (5.898 m)Internal Width7.7 ft (2.352 m)Internal Height7.9 ft (2.393 m)Maximum Gross Weight24,000 kg (52,910 lbs)Tare Weight2,300 kg (5,071 lbs)Payload21,700 kg (47,852 pounds)Types of 20 Ft Box Containers

Just how much can a 20 ft box container hold?
A standard 20 ft box container can hold up to 21,700 kg (47,852 pounds) of cargo, translating to roughly 1,172 cubic feet of volume.

5. What are the shipping choices for a 20 ft box container?
Numerous shipping alternatives are available, including FCL (Full Container Load), LCL (Less than Container Load), rail transportation, and trucking.
